Back in November of 2021, I wrote this song at the lowest point in my creative confidence, being the first song I wrote sober in 2 years. I felt like Charles Barkley in Space Jam shooting his first free throw after the Monstars took his talent. Feeling as if I had lost not only my skill, but my passion for music as well. I wanted to quit music, and I wanted to quit in life. Unfortunately, these days I feel that this disposition has become commonplace in our generation, many of us frequently feeling out of place. Yet, I remained unyielding, and did not give in to giving up. I created this out of desperation yearning to create again and be comfortable in my own skin as an artist. I have no other choice to continue on this path, I have sown too many seeds, spending hours upon hours laboring and toiling, to give up before the harvest.
Let this song and every song I release after this be a testament of faith in my artistry.
And if this speaks to you and you believe in what I do, share this with every soul you think could benefit from hearing this song. Because I cannot do this alone and would love your help sharing this with the world.
I wouldn’t consider this song to be my best, nor my worst, but a very real reflection of who I am as a human and as an artist in this moment.
I present to you “Da Balance”
